The recent emergence of SARS-CoV-2 and resultant pandemic of COVID-19 disease has overwhelmed global health systems and led to over 200,000 American deaths to date. While initial reports suggested that SARS-CoV-2 infection in children was generally benign, a novel post-inflammatory syndrome known as multisystem inflammatory syndrome in children (MIS-C) has now been described. MIS-C in children is characterized by fever, systemic inflammation, and end-organ involvement, and the majority of patients are IgG seropositive for SARS-CoV-2. Because the clinical features of MIS-C overlap with other infections and inflammatory disorders, new strategies for diagnosis of MIS-C in febrile children are urgently needed. The immediate objective of this study was to determine the reproducible changes in breath, urine, and salivary volatile composition in children diagnosed with MIS-C. These discovery studies were integrated with clinical and immunological profiling to develop and validate a novel and much-needed MIS-C diagnostic, which was expected to have a major impact on care of febrile children. The long-term goal of this study was to develop a diagnostic strategy to distinguish children with MIS-C from children with other causes of fever.
